Output e2405b853bea9316acc27e60650512cbf7bb87fe4ac8648d31117e99946cb0ff:0

value
2891109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74d757e18476bb858805ae61fe45c7ea52d3f50 OP_EQUAL
address
3KrqBfGRWNqiSXHGiBBsEZFAgWgxm4YmYa
transaction
e2405b853bea9316acc27e60650512cbf7bb87fe4ac8648d31117e99946cb0ff
spent
true